Apcom Essencias company history timeline

1972

A. O. Smith was a leading supplier of line pipe until it exited the business in 1972.

1982

In 1982, APCOM purchased Volunteer Tool & Die, Inc., located in Cookeville, Tennessee.

1986

Business expands into supplying oil field pipe and pipe for service stations, eventually becoming Smith Fiberglass Products in 1986.

2001

Since 2001, APCOM has been a part of the A. O. Smith Corporation family of companies.

2002

The protective coatings group was added to the APCOM portfolio of products in 2002.

2011

A. O. Smith buys Lochinvar (July 2011).

2013

A. O. Smith buys MiM Water Technologies in Istanbul, Turkey (February 2013), entering the water treatment market.
